How Zenof O Z Suspension works:

Zenof O Z Suspension is an antibiotic formulation containing ofloxacin and ornidazole. These active components disrupt bacterial DNA replication, effectively eliminating infectious bacteria and halting their proliferation. This mechanism helps prevent the development of antibiotic resistance.

SAFETY ADVICE

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Zenof O Z Suspension judiciously. Dosage modifications for Zenof O Z Suspension may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should exercise caution when using Zenof O Z Suspension. A modified dosage of Zenof O Z Suspension might be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take Zenof O Z Suspension :

Remain calm. Administer the medication upon recollection, unless otherwise directed by your pediatrician's prescribed schedule. If uncertain, contact your doctor; avoid doubling the dose to compensate for a missed one.

FAQs on Zenof O Z Suspension

Zenof O Z Suspension may interact negatively with cough and cold medications, especially those containing alcohol. Always consult a doctor before giving your child any other medicine while they are taking Zenof O Z Suspension to avoid potential adverse reactions.
While a single extra dose of Zenof O Z Suspension is unlikely to harm your child, avoid overdosing on any medication. Contact a doctor immediately if you suspect an overdose. Excessive amounts may cause serious side effects including seizures, tremors, severe headache, sudden weakness, blood cell abnormalities, and rapid or irregular heartbeat. Seek immediate medical attention if your child experiences any of these symptoms.
Lack of improvement suggests the medication may be ineffective against the bacteria. Consult your child's doctor; they might prescribe a broader-spectrum antibiotic than Zenof O Z Suspension, possibly administered intravenously in a hospital setting.
Zenof O Z Suspension may interact with other medications. Inform your child's doctor of all other medications your child is taking before beginning treatment with Zenof O Z Suspension, and always consult your child's doctor before administering any medication.
Generally, antibiotics don't affect vaccines or cause adverse reactions in recently vaccinated children. However, vaccination should be postponed until recovery from an illness requiring antibiotics. The vaccine can be administered once your child is well.
Please inform your doctor if your child has, or has had, heart disease, blood vessel genetic disorders, seizures, psychiatric disorders, diabetes, sun allergy (photoallergy), neuromuscular disorders, or rheumatoid arthritis. Zenof O Z Suspension may worsen these conditions, potentially causing complications.
Zenof O Z Suspension combines Ofloxacin and Ornidazole to effectively combat harmful microorganisms, thereby treating infections.
Zenof O Z Suspension is generally well-tolerated. However, some individuals may experience side effects such as nausea, vomiting, stomach pain, dizziness, headache, dry mouth, or heartburn. Less common or rare side effects are also possible. Contact your doctor if any side effects persist.
Patients allergic to ofloxacin, ornidazole, or other quinolone or nitroimidazole antimicrobials should not use Zenof O Z Suspension due to the risk of harm.
Exceeding the recommended dosage of Zenof O Z Suspension raises the risk of side effects. If your symptoms worsen despite taking the prescribed dose, consult your doctor for reassessment.
Contact your doctor if your symptoms worsen during treatment or persist after completing the prescribed course.
Continue taking Zenof O Z Suspension as prescribed, completing the entire course even if you feel better. Full recovery requires finishing the medication, as symptoms can improve before the infection is completely eradicated.
Remember to take Zenof O Z Suspension as soon as you recall, unless it's nearly time for your next dose. Do not double the dose to compensate for a missed one.
To minimize dizziness and drowsiness from Zenof O Z Suspension, avoid alcohol. If you have concerns, talk to your doctor.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the label or packaging. Discard any unused medication and keep it out of reach of children, pets, and others.
